Volleyball Recap: Warren Dragons vs. Fort LeBoeuf Bison
It can be hard to translate regular season success to the playoffs, but Warren had no problem doing just that on Tuesday. They came out on top against the Fort LeBoeuf Bison by a score of 3-1. The victory was nothing new for the Dragons as they're now sitting on five straight.
Warren was especially dominant in the first set.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-14, 13-25, 25-20, 25-22.
Warren found their leader in sophomore Malysia Sorensen, who had 17 digs.
Warren has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won eight of their last nine matches, which provided a nice bump to their 34-3-4 record this season. As for Fort LeBoeuf,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 7-7.
